AgustaWestland To Expand Facilities In Brazil

Expanded Space Could Eventually Contain A Helicopter Final Assembly Line

AgustaWestland's Brazilian subsidiary AgustaWestland Do Brasil is to undergo a major expansion with the building of a new facility in Sao Paulo which will include maintenance hangars with space that could accommodate a helicopter final assembly line, training center, bonded warehouse, workshops and other supporting services including a dedicated heliport.

Cessna Sees Continued Demand In Latin American Business Jet Market

Planemaker Seeing Strong Demand In Brazil In Particular

Latin America is a strong region for Cessna, according to the company's senior vice president for sales. Speaking at LBACE this week, Kriya Shortt said that the company has "several exciting new products out this year, including the revolutionary new Citation Sovereign, high-performance Cessna TTx and powerful Grand Caravan EX, all of which we expect to be extremely popular with our Latin American customers."
